The Ixora plant, often called the Jungle Geranium, is celebrated for its striking, vibrant clusters of red, orange, or yellow flowers that bring a tropical appeal to any garden or home. Despite its beauty, the Ixora can be temperamental, requiring specific care. If your plant is showing yellow leaves, dropping buds, or stunted growth, it is signaling that its environment is no longer meeting its precise needs. Understanding the fundamental requirements of this tropical shrub is the first step in diagnosing and reversing its decline.
Understanding Ixora’s Basic Needs
Ixora is a tropical evergreen shrub that requires conditions similar to its native environment in South Asia to thrive. The plant needs bright light for abundant flowering, ideally receiving six to eight hours of direct sunlight daily. While it can tolerate some afternoon shade in hot climates, insufficient light results in sparse foliage and a lack of blooms.
This shrub is sensitive to cold, preferring consistent temperatures between 60°F and 85°F. Temperatures below 60°F or exposure to cold drafts cause stress, leading to leaf drop and decline. High humidity is also beneficial for the Ixora. Indoor plants often do best in humid areas like bathrooms or on pebble trays that increase localized moisture.
The composition of the soil is a defining factor in Ixora health, as the plant is a strict acid-lover. It requires a slightly acidic soil pH ranging from 5.5 to 6.5 for optimal nutrient absorption. When the soil becomes neutral or alkaline (pH above 7.0), the plant cannot efficiently take up micronutrients, which commonly causes foliage problems.
Diagnosing Watering and Nutrient Imbalances
Improper watering is a frequent cause of distress in Ixora, and the symptoms of overwatering and underwatering can appear similar. An overwatered plant often displays yellowing leaves and wilting, despite the soil being wet, because the roots are suffocating and cannot transport water or nutrients. Overwatering leads to root rot, identified by soft, brown, or black mushy roots and stems.
Conversely, an underwatered Ixora will also wilt or droop, but its leaves may develop crispy, brown edges before dropping off. The soil will be visibly dry and pull away from the sides of the pot. To correct this, ensure the soil is consistently moist but never soggy, allowing the top inch to dry slightly before watering deeply.
The distinct yellowing of leaves in Ixora is often a sign of chlorosis, stemming from a micronutrient deficiency, specifically iron. Iron chlorosis is characterized by new growth showing yellow leaves while the leaf veins remain green, a pattern called interveinal chlorosis. This occurs because alkaline soil prevents the plant from accessing iron, even if the element is present.
To address iron chlorosis, intervention is required to make the iron available to the plant. Applying a chelated iron product directly to the soil is the most effective method, as chelated forms bypass the pH-related absorption problem. Foliar sprays containing iron can also provide a temporary greening effect on the leaves while you work to acidify the soil long-term.
Identifying and Treating Pests and Diseases
Ixora plants are susceptible to common garden pests that thrive on the plant’s sap. Scale insects, mealybugs, and aphids are the most frequently encountered threats. An infestation is often indicated by honeydew, a sticky, sugary residue excreted by these pests. Honeydew can lead to the growth of sooty mold, a black fungus that covers the leaves and interferes with photosynthesis.
Mealybugs appear as small, white, cottony masses clustered in leaf axils and along stems. Scale insects look like tiny, immobile brown or gray bumps on the stems and leaves. Aphids are small, soft-bodied insects, often green or black, that congregate on new growth. Treating these pests involves manual removal for small infestations or applying horticultural oil, such as neem oil, which suffocates the insects.
Fungal issues can arise from poor air circulation and excessive moisture, often manifesting as sooty mold on the honeydew left by pests. Root rot is a fungal disease caused by persistently waterlogged soil, which is prevented by ensuring excellent drainage. Improving air movement around the plant and applying a preventative fungicide helps mitigate the risk of fungal spread.
Developing a Recovery Plan for Stressed Plants
For a severely declining Ixora, a structured recovery plan requires environmental adjustments and physical interventions. The first step is to conserve the plant’s energy by pruning away any dead wood, diseased foliage, or weak growth. You can test the viability of a stem by gently bending it; a healthy stem is flexible, while a dead one snaps cleanly.
If the potted plant is struggling with suspected overwatering or poor drainage, a root check is warranted. Carefully remove the plant from its container and inspect the roots. Trim away any roots that are dark brown or black and soft to the touch using sterilized shears. Repot the plant into a container with fresh, well-draining, acidic potting mix.
Once physical interventions are complete, move the plant to a location that provides ideal light and temperature conditions, ensuring protection from cold drafts. Avoid applying heavy doses of high-nitrogen fertilizer during the initial recovery phase. The plant needs to focus energy on root and foliage repair, not forced growth. Instead, use a balanced, acid-loving fertilizer sparingly, focusing on correcting the soil pH and providing iron supplements to stabilize foliage color.
